DG721, DG722, DG723
Vishay Siliconix
1.8 V to 5.5 V, 4
Dual SPST Switches
DESCRIPTION
The DG721, DG722 and DG723 are precision dual SPST
switches designed to operate from single 1.8 V to 5.5 V
power supply with low power dissipation. The DG721,
DG722 and DG723 can switch both analog and digital
signals within the power supply rail, and conduct well in both
directions.
Fabricated with advance submicron CMOS process, these
switches provide high precision low and flat ON resistance,
low leakage current, low parasitic capacitance, and low
charge injection.
The DG721, DG722 and DG723 contain two independent
Single Pole Single Throw (SPST) switches. Switch-1 and
switch-2 are normally open for the DG721 and normally
closed for the DG722. For the DG723, switch-1 is normally
open and switch-2 is normally closed with a Break-Before-
Make switching timing.
The DG721, DG722 and DG723 are the ideal switches for
use in low voltage instruments and healthcare devices, fitting
the circuits of low voltage ADC and DAC, analog front end
gain control, and signal path control.
As a committed partner to the community and the
environment, Vishay Siliconix manufactures this product with
lead (Pb)-free device termination. The TDFN8 package has
a nickel-palladium-gold device termination and is
represented by the lead (Pb)-free “-E4” suffix to the ordering
part number. The MSOP-8 package has tin device
termination and is represented by “-E3”. Both device
terminations meet all JEDEC standards for reflow and MSL
rating.
As a further sign of Vishay Siliconix's commitment, the
DG721, DG722 and D723 are fully RoHS compliant and
Halogen-free.
FEATURES
Halogen-free according to IEC 61249-2-21
definition
• 1.8 V to 5.5 V single power supply
• Low and flat switch on resistance, 2.5
/typ.
• Low leakage and parasitic capacitance
• 366 MHz, - 3 dB bandwidth
• Latch-up current > 300 mA (JESD78)
• Space saving packages
2 mm x 2 mm TDFN8
MSOP8
• Over voltage tolerant TTL/CMOS compatible
Compliant to RoHS Directive 2002/95/EC
APPLICATIONS
Healthcare and medical devices
Test instruments
Portable meters
Data acquisitions
Control and automation
PDAs and modems
Communication systems
Audio, video systems
Mechanical reed relay replacement
